- Bridgman, Michigan - Wikipedia
Bridgman is a city in Berrien County in the U S state of Michigan The population was 2,096 at the time of the 2020 census [4] There was a place in this area known as Plummer's Pier In 1856 lumbermen founded Charlotteville in this area Bridgman itself begins with the village of that name platted by George C Bridgman in 1870

- Percy Williams Bridgman - Wikipedia
Percy Williams Bridgman (April 21, 1882 – August 20, 1961) was an American physicist who received the Nobel Prize in Physics in 1946 for his work on the physics of high pressures
